Agile release planning is a flexible process that guides development teams in delivering software increments in a consistent manner. It focuses on collaboration, transparency, and continuous improvement. By segmenting large projects into smaller, tangible chunks, agile release planning supports teams to respond to changing requirements and ensure a rhythmic flow of value.

Through iterative cycles of planning, development, and review, agile release planning fosters a culture of optimization. Teams constantly reassess their backlog, ensuring that the valuable features are delivered first. This sequential approach amplifies team velocity and provides a high-quality product that fulfills customer requirements.

Agile Release Planning Toolkit

In the fast-paced realm of software development, efficient release planning is paramount for achieving objectives. An effective Agile Release Planning Toolkit equips teams with the necessary tools to navigate this complex process. These tools empower stakeholders to collaboratively design project roadmaps, monitor progress, and identify potential bottlenecks. A well-chosen toolkit can materially enhance the transparency and predictability of Agile releases, leading to faster time-to-market and increased customer happiness.

  • Kanban Project Management Software: Platforms like Jira or Azure DevOps provide a centralized hub for tracking tasks, backlog items, and sprints.
  • Workflow Tools: Communication channels like Slack or Microsoft Teams facilitate real-time discussions and data sharing among team members.
  • Release Automation Tools: Tools like Jenkins or CircleCI automate the build, test, and deployment processes, eliminating manual effort and improving release speed.
